Golden Hour Maternity Shoot at Caldicot Castle


There’s something truly magical about golden hour at Caldicot Castle — the kind of light that makes everything feel warm, calm, and full of life. I met with Emily for her second trimester maternity shoot, and it couldn’t have been a more perfect evening.


This session is part of a beautiful series we’ve been capturing together throughout her pregnancy — one photoshoot for each trimester — to tell the full story of her journey into motherhood.


For this shoot, Emily kept things simple and timeless, wearing jeans and a crisp white shirt. It was the perfect choice for the relaxed, natural style we wanted to capture. As the evening sun dipped behind the castle walls, the soft golden light wrapped around her beautifully — she was truly glowing.

Caldicot Castle, with its peaceful grounds and historic charm, created the most stunning backdrop. The mix of old stone walls, lush green surroundings, and that warm golden glow gave every image a sense of calm and connection.


What I loved most about this session was how effortless it felt. There was laughter, quiet moments, and that unmistakable joy that comes with expecting a little one. Emily’s confidence and glow during this stage of her pregnancy really shone through in every frame.


I can’t wait to photograph Emily again in her third trimester and complete this little journey we’ve been documenting together. These maternity photoshoots in South Wales are such a wonderful way to pause, reflect, and celebrate each chapter of pregnancy ; a time that passes by far too quickly.
